A fight has erupted outside the courtroom where two people charged with murder appeared in Christchurch on Monday morning.

The victim, in his 60s, was found with serious head injuries in a Sumner carpark on Thursday night and died in hospital at the weekend.

When the 38-year-old woman and 20-year-old man appeared in the Christchurch District Court, several people stormed out of the court and a fight erupted in the foyer.

A Newshub cameraman was shoved as it spilled outside.

The man was found around 10pm by a member of the public, after which he was taken to hospital to undergo surgery.

Police said on Friday that the woman had been arrested and charged with assault with intent to cause grievous bodily harm in relation to the incident.

Following the man's death, the charges were upgraded to murder.

A 16-year-old was initially charged with burglary, and with being an accessory after the fact.
